NAPKINS WITH A TWISTZ: FABULOUS FOLDS WITH FLAIR FOR EVERY OCCASSION by STARK, DAVID (Hardcover - 2006)
ISBN: 9781579652968
Subject: SPORTS, HOBBIES & GAMES
Publisher: ARTISAN US

Take simple squares of cloth, succinctly written directions, and clearly photographed steps and create fantastic napkin folds that transform your table into a showpiece. Mixing whimsy and elegance, celebrity event designer David Stark fashions stylish setups for every occasion. In Napkins with a Twist, Stark turns his unerring eye to the art of the perfect table setting, focusing on the quick, inexpensive, and creative. From everyday to evening, childrenˇ¦s parties to black-tie affairs, a clever napkin fold turns any gathering into a memorable event. Classic folds such as the Tuxedo Fold, together with Starkˇ¦s own innovative designs ˇV including the wildly fun Fortune Cookie and Sushi Roll folds ˇV make setting the table a no-brainer.

PLATTER OF FIGS AND OTHER RECIPES by TANIS, DAVID (Hardcover - 2008)
ISBN: 9781579653460
Subject: FOOD AND DRINK
Publisher: ARTISAN US

In this eloquent appeal for good sense in cooking great food, Davis Tanis serves up twenty-four seasonal menus that are simply conceived and simply servedˇXon platters, family style. His food bursts with invention and flavor, such as wild salmon with spicy Vietnamese cucumbers to celebrate spring and braised duck with fried ginger for a cool-weather dinner. Deliciously down-to-earth, his intuitive menus make cooking a pleasure, not a stressˇXwhether you're "Feeling Italian" (Steamed Fennel with Red Pepper Oil; Roasted Quail with Grilled Radicchio and Creamy Polenta; Italian Plum Cake) or "Slightly All-American" (Sliced Tomatoes with Sea Salt; Grilled Chicken Breasts; Corn, Squash, and Beans with Jalape?ˇÓo Butter; Blueberry-Blackberry Crumble). Here, at last, is a cookbook that has nothing to do with celebrity chefdom and everything to do with real life. Cancel the dinner reservations and pick up this bookˇXand rediscover the pleasure of cooking at home.
